“Riverside” is a contemporary semi-abstract work. The painting explores a landscape that straddles the boundary between reality and the imagination.
Minimalism blends with rich textures created using acrylic paint and marble dust.
The forms suggest an open, gentle, and introspective landscape where light seems to float.

Inspired by a walk near the Étangs de Hollande, the piece evokes a peaceful natural setting steeped in history.
These historic ponds—originally created in the 17th century to supply water to the fountains at the Palace of Versailles—are now a nature reserve teeming with birdlife.

Balancing memory and contemplation, “Riverside” invites the viewer to escape into an atmosphere that is at once calm, melancholic, and deeply alive.
